Homeschooling & Alternative Schools

Homeschooling is any form of learning that takes place at home, in the community, support groups or at alternative schools. Called Ensino Doméstico in Portugal, homeschooling is the legal, flexible learning that happens away from formal Portuguese schools. Transferring to a Portuguese school: what to do

Transferring to a Portuguese school: When to apply? Transferring to a Portuguese school is a priority and a legal requirement if your child is at school age, from 6 to 18 years old.
